had to make her something... she had just moved into a new apartment the weekend before, so I wanted to make her something "homey." And this is what I came up with...

A framed, 8x10 collage of homemade goodness.
Sorry about the awful glare.
This is the top of the collage. I cut out an airplane from the Studio Calico paper and also fussy cut some clouds. The birdie is a pin from K&Co.

Bottom: I personalized a die cut label
"Louisville to Chicago and back again... welcome home Megan!" I added the fleur-de-lis charm to the handmade house found at
Trinkets NH.

This is the left side: I used a die cut vintage key and attached it with a button and red twine. I love the "LIVE" tag- it just worked perfectly with this project!

And finally, the right side: a personalized mailbox. Probably my fave... Megan's last name starts with a "B" so I added a little monogram.
